I am constantly amazed in my own work (both as a yoga teacher and a marketing consultant) by the power of relationship. Marketing is not a drive-through event. There is no magic bullet. Instead, marketing is a commitment over time.

From my perspective, there are three distinct steps:

1. Get students in the door
2. Make sure they have a positive experience
3. Encourage their practice by staying in contact with them.
